§ 48-13-62 — Failure to keep and open records; punishment

Georgia·Title 48
(a)It shall be unlawful for any innkeeper subject to this article to fail to keep records or to fail to open the records to inspection as required by law.
(b)Any person who violates subsection (a) of this Code section shall be guilty of a misdemeanor.
